The Springport Spartans won the last time they faced the Hanover-Horton Comets, and things went their way on Friday too. Springport enjoyed a cozy 45-26 victory over the Comets. The victory made it back-to-back wins for Springport.
Maddux Locke continued her habit of posting crazy stat lines, scoring 20 points along with seven rebounds and five assists. Locke is crushing the steal category: she's posted at least three every time she's taken the court this season. Another player making a difference was Hope Overweg, who scored seven points along with 11 rebounds and two steals.
Springport's victory bumped their record up to 11-3. As for Hanover-Horton, their loss dropped their record down to 8-5.
